Santa Cruz was a really cute little beach town. It was exactly what you picture a california town to be like. People Roller Scatting and on scate boards along the beach front and full of friendly people.
When I arrived there i was having trouble finding my hostel and this really nice lady over heard me asking for directions and offered me a lift and showed me around the town. And then another time, me and a friend from the hostel stopped in a reasturant for coffee had about 5 cups and then went to pay and they were like dont worry about it, have a good day!!
I went to one of the free beach concerts they have every friday night in Summer, and watched the band that sing 'we built this city on rock and roll' cant remember the name of the band, but it was really good.
The best thing about Santa Cruz was the hostel. Althought it was weird, cause you had to leave at 11am and could return until 5pm and had to be in by 11pm every night or you got locked out. But is was so cozy, had like a little cottage, with 2 rooms coming of it and then a TV room with compy sofas and a dvd and viedo player. And the best best thing was that they treated you to free food all the time, like the kitchen was packed full of food to eat, from veggies and pasta to millions of cakes and pastrys, Just loads of stuff.
